数据库的安全机制中,通过GRANT语句实现的是( );通过建立( )使用户只能看到部分数据,从而保护了其它数据;通过提供(请作答此空)供第三方开发人员调用进行数据更新,从而保证数据库的关系模式不被第三方所获取。A.索引 B.视图 C.存储过程 D.触发器

题目
数据库的安全机制中,通过GRANT语句实现的是( );通过建立( )使用户只能看到部分数据,从而保护了其它数据;通过提供(请作答此空)供第三方开发人员调用进行数据更新,从而保证数据库的关系模式不被第三方所获取。

A.索引
B.视图
C.存储过程
D.触发器

相似考题
更多“数据库的安全机制中,通过GRANT语句实现的是( );通过建立( )使用户只能看到部分数据,从而保护了其它数据;通过提供(请作答此空)供第三方开发人员调用进行数据更新,从而保证数据库的关系模式不被第三方所获取。”相关问题
  • 第1题:

    数据库的安全机制中,通过GRANT语句实现的是( );通过建立( ) 使用户只能看到部分数据,从而保护了其它数据;通过提供( )供第三方开发人 员调用进行数据更新,从而保证数据库的关系模式不被第三方所获取。

    A.用户授权 B.许可证 C.加密 D.回收权限 A.索引 B.视图 C.存储过程 D.触发器 A.索引 B.视图 C.存储过程 D.触发器


    正确答案:A,B,C

  • 第2题:

    在数据库系统中,数据的(请作答此空)是指保护数据库,以防止不合法的使用所造成的数据泄漏、更改或破坏;数据的( )是指数据库正确性和相容性,是防止合法用户使用数据库时向数据库加入不符合语义的数据。

    A.安全性
    B.可靠性
    C.完整性
    D.并发控制

    答案:A
    解析:
    本题考查数据库系统概念方面的基本概念。
    数据控制功能包括对数据库中数据的安全性、完整性、并发和恢复的控制。其中:
    ①安全性(security)是指保护数据库受恶意访问,即防止不合法的使用所造成的数据泄漏、更改或破坏。这样,用户只能按规定对数据进行处理,例如,划分了不同的权限,有的用户只能有读数据的权限,有的用户有修改数据的权限,用户只能在规定的权限范围内操纵数据库。
    ②完整性(integrality)是指数据库正确性和相容性,是防止合法用户使用数据库时向数据库加入不符合语义的数据。保证数据库中数据是正确的,避免非法的更新。
    ③并发控制(concurrency control)是指在多用户共享的系统中,许多用户可能同时对同一数据进行操作。DBMS的并发控制子系统负责协调并发事务的执行,保证数据库的完整性不受破坏,避免用户得到不正确的数据。
    ④故障恢复(recovery from failure)。数据库中的4类故障是事务内部故障、系统故障、介质故障及计算机病毒。故障恢复主要是指恢复数据库本身,即在故障引起数据库当前状态不一致后,将数据库恢复到某个正确状态或一致状态。恢复的原理非常简单,就是要建立冗余(redundancy)数据。换句话说,确定数据库是否可恢复的方法就是其包含的每一条信息是否都可以利用冗余地存储在别处的信息重构。冗余是物理级的,通常认为逻辑级是没有冗余的。

  • 第3题:

    数据库重构是指因为性能原因,对数据库中的某个表进行分解,再通过建立与原表同名的(请作答此空)以保证查询该表的应用程序不变;通过修改更新原表的( )以保证外部程序对数据库的更新调用不变。

    A.视图
    B.索引
    C.存储过程
    D.触发器

    答案:A
    解析:
    本题考査系统设计及维护相关知识。视图提供了数据的逻辑独立性,即关系模式发生改变之后,通过修改外模式/模式的映象,达到应用程序不变的目的,因为査询语句中不区分所査的对象是表还是视图。对数据的更新应使用存储过程实现,关系模式发生改变后,这部分对应的更新操作也应该在相应的存储过程中进行修改。

  • 第4题:

    在数据库设计过程中,设计用户外模式属于(请作答此空);数据的物理独立性和数据的逻辑独立性是分别通过修改( )来完成的。

    A.概念结构设计
    B.物理设计
    C.逻辑结构设计
    D.数据库实施

    答案:C
    解析:
    本题考査对数据库基本概念掌握程度。在数据库设计过程中,外模式设计是在数据库各关系模式确定之后,根据应用需求来确定各个应用所用到的数据视图即外模式的,故设计用户外模式属于逻辑结构设计。数据的独立性是由DBMS的二级映像功能来保证的。数据的独立性包括数据的物理独立性和数据的逻辑独立性。数据的物理独立性是指当数据库的内模式发生改变时,数据的逻辑结构不变。为了保证应用程序能够正确执行,需要通过修改概念模式/内模式之间的映像。数据的逻辑独立性是指用户的应用程序与数据库的逻辑结构是相互独立的。数据的逻辑结构发生变化后,用户程序也可以不修改。但是,为了保证应用程序能够正确执行,需要修改外模式/概念模式之间的映像。

  • 第5题:

    若系统中的某子模块需要为其他模块提供访问不同数据库系统的功能,这些数据库系统提供的访问接口有一定的差异,但访问过程却都是相同的,例如,先连接数据库,再打开数据库,最后对数据进行查询。针对上述需求,可以采用( )设计模式抽象出相同的数据库访问过程,该设计模式(请作答此空)。

    A.可以动态、透明地给单个对象添加职责
    B.为子系统定义了一个高层接口,这个接口使得这一子系统更加容易使用
    C.通过运用共享技术,有效支持大量细粒度的对象
    D.将抽象部分与它的实现部分分离,使它们都可以独立地变化

    答案:B
    解析:
    外观(fagade)模式是对象的结构模式,要求外部与一个子系统的通信必须通过一个统一的外观对象进行,为子系统中的一组接口提供一个一致的界面,外观模式定义了一个高层接口,这个接口使得这一子系统更加容易使用

  • 第6题:

    关系数据库语言SQL除了数据操作以外,还提供了数据控制的功能,其授权和收回就是通过其提供的GOTO语句和REVOKE语句来实现的。


    正确答案:错误

  • 第7题:

    如果在新建用户时指定了IDENTIFIED EXTERNALLY子句,则说明这个用户符合下列()身份验证。

    • A、只能通过数据库进行身份验证。
    • B、可以通过数据库进行身份验证,并且可以不提供口令。
    • C、只能通过操作系统进行身份验证。
    • D、只能通过外部的网络服务进行身份验证。

    正确答案:C

  • 第8题:

    通过数据库系统,建立严格的()机制,保证数据库中存储数据的正确与完整

    • A、数据稽
    • B、数据更新
    • C、数据监督
    • D、数据检查

    正确答案:A

  • 第9题:

    在VB应用程序中,经常需要通过访问数据库服务器来获取或者储存数据,以下关于数据库服务器的作用的描述,错误的是()。

    • A、实现保护数据库信息的备份和恢复功能
    • B、向最终用户显示输出结果
    • C、控制数据库访问和其它安全需求
    • D、管理多个用户在同一时间对单个数据库的访问

    正确答案:B

  • 第10题:

    单选题
    拒绝服务类安全事件是指由于()使系统无法为正常用户提供服务所引起的安全事件。
    A

    恶意用户利用以太网监听、键盘记录等方法获取未授权的信息或资料

    B

    恶意用户通过提交特殊的参数从而达到获取数据库中存储的数据、得到数据库用户的权限

    C

    恶意用户利用发送虚假电子邮件、建立虚假服务网站、发送虚假网络消息等方法

    D

    恶意用户利用系统的安全漏洞对系统进行未授权的访问或破坏E.恶意用户利用挤占带宽、消耗系统资源等攻击方法


    正确答案: B
    解析: 暂无解析

  • 第11题:

    单选题
    关系数据库语言SQL除了数据操作以外,还提供了数据控制的功能,其授权和收回就是通过其提供的()语句和REVOKE语句来实现的。
    A

    DENY

    B

    DCL

    C

    GRANT

    D

    GOTO


    正确答案: D
    解析: 暂无解析

  • 第12题:

    填空题
    在数据库的体系结构中,数据库存储的改变会引起内模式的改变。为使数据库的模式保持不变,从而不必修改应用程序,这是通过改变模式与内模式之间的映象来实现的。这样,使数据库具有()。

    正确答案: 物理独立性/数据物理独立性
    解析: 暂无解析

  • 第13题:

    数据库的安全机制中,采用 GRANT语句实现的是( )。

    A.加密
    B.许可证
    C.用户授权
    D.回收权限

    答案:C
    解析:
    在数据库中,GRANT是授予对数据库的权限。

  • 第14题:

    数据库中数据的(请作答此空)是指数据库的正确性和相容性,以防止合法用户向数据库加入不符合语义的数据;( )是指保护数据库,以防止不合法的使用所造成的数据泄漏、更改或破坏;( )是指在多用户共享的系统中,保证数据库的完整性不受破坏,避免用户得到不正确的数据。

    A.安全性
    B.可靠性
    C.完整性
    D.并发控制

    答案:C
    解析:
    在数据库系统中,数据的完整性是指数据库的正确性和相容性,以防止合法用户向数据库加入不符合语义的数据;安全性是指保护数据库,以防止不合法的使用所造成的数据泄漏、更改或破坏;并发控制是指在多用户共享的系统中,保证数据库的完整性不受破坏,避免用户得到不正确的数据。

  • 第15题:

    数据库的安全机制中,通过GRANT语句实现的是(请作答此空);通过建立( )使用户只能看到部分数据,从而保护了其它数据;通过提供( )供第三方开发人员调用进行数据更新,从而保证数据库的关系模式不被第三方所获取。

    A.用户授权
    B.许可证
    C.加密
    D.回收权限

    答案:A
    解析:
    本题考查数据库安全性的基础知识。GRANT是标准SQL提供的授权语句,即通过把数据库对象的操作权限授予用户,用户具有对象上的操作权限才能进行相应的操作。视图是建立在基本表上的虚表,通过外模式/模式的映像,将视阁所提供的字段(外模式)指向基本表(模式)中的部分数据,用户通过视图所访问的数据只是对应基本表中的部分数据,而无需给用户提供基本表中的全部数据,则视图外的数据对用户是不可见的,即受到了保护。存储过程是数据库所提供的一种数据库对象,通过存储过程定义一段代码,提供给应用程序调用来执行。从安全性的角度考虑,更新数据时,通过提供存储过程让第三方凋用,将需要更新的数据传入存储过程,而在存储过程内部用代码分别对需要的多个表进行更新,从而避免了向第三方提供系统的表结构,保证了系统的数据安全。

  • 第16题:

    数据库的安全机制中,通过提供( )第三方开发人员调用进行数据更新,从而保证数据库的关系模式不被第三方所获取。

    A.素引
    B.视图
    C.存储过程
    D.触发器

    答案:C
    解析:

  • 第17题:

    某高校管理信息系统的数据库设计过程中,( )阶段是在需求分析的基础上,对用户信息加以分类、聚集和概括,建立信息模型,并依照选定的数据库管理系统软件,转换成为数据的(请作答此空),再依照软硬件环境,最终实现数据的合理存储。

    A. 物理模式
    B. 逻辑模式
    C. 内模式
    D. 概念模式

    答案:B
    解析:
    本题考查的是应试者对数据库基本概念的掌握程度。第一空、第二空的正确答案分别为D和B。数据库概念结构设计阶段是在需求分析的基础上,依照需求分析中的信息要求,对用户信息方加以分类、聚集和概括,建立信息模型,并依照选定的数据库管理系统软件,转换成为数据库的逻辑模式,再依照软硬件环境,最终实现数据的合理存储。这—过程也称为数据建模。

  • 第18题:

    JDBC可以做哪三件事()

    • A、与数据库建立连接
    • B、通过JDBC-API向数据库发送SQL语句
    • C、通过JDBC-API执行SQL语句
    • D、进行实体关系的映射

    正确答案:A,B,C

  • 第19题:

    通过数据库系统,建立严格的数据稽查机制,保证数据库中存储数据的正确与完整


    正确答案:正确

  • 第20题:

    ()是数据库系统的核心组成部分,它是用户和数据库之间的接口,数据库的一切操作,如查询、更新、插入、删除以及各种控制,都是通过它进行的。


    正确答案:数据库管理系统

  • 第21题:

    判断题
    通过数据库系统,建立严格的数据稽查机制,保证数据库中存储数据的正确与完整
    A

    B


    正确答案:
    解析: 暂无解析

  • 第22题:

    判断题
    关系数据库语言SQL除了数据操作以外,还提供了数据控制的功能,其授权和收回就是通过其提供的GOTO语句和REVOKE语句来实现的。
    A

    B


    正确答案:
    解析: 暂无解析

  • 第23题:

    单选题
    通过数据库系统,建立严格的()机制,保证数据库中存储数据的正确与完整
    A

    数据稽

    B

    数据更新

    C

    数据监督

    D

    数据检查


    正确答案: B
    解析: 暂无解析